Elective Total Hip Arthroplasty (THA) Cohort
The elective THA cohort is defined by a principal procedure of Total Hip Arthroplasty, excluding a number of other conditions and procedures that would indicate the procedure is not elective or that increase the likelihood of complications. This is aligned with the CMS Procedure-Specific Readmission Measure for elective THA/TKA.

Cohort inclusions
To be eligible for the THA Cohort, the encounter must have an ICD-10 Principal Procedure Code for a hip replacement (one of: 0SR9019, 0SR901A, 0SR901Z, 0SR9029, 0SR902A, 0SR902Z, 0SR9039, 0SR903Z, 0SR9049, 0SR904A, 0SR904Z, 0SR90J9, 0SR90JA, 0SR90JZ, 0SRB019, 0SRB01A, 0SRB01Z, 0SRB029, 0SRB02A, 0SRB02Z, 0SRB039, 0SRB03A, 0SRB03Z, 0SRB049, 0SRB04A, 0SRB04Z, 0SRB0J9, 0SRB0JA, or 0SRB0JZ).
Cohort exclusions
Encounters with any of the following conditions are excluded from the cohort:
- Any diagnosis code for pelvic fracture or fracture of lower limbs
- Any procedure code for partial hip arthroplasty
- Any procedure for revision, resurfacing, or implanted device/prosthesis removal
- Principal diagnosis is for mechanical complication
- Principal diagnosis is for malignant neoplasm of pelvis, sacrum, coccyx, lower limbs, or bone/marrow or a disseminated malignant neoplasm
- Admission source or discharge disposition indicates transfer
- More than 3 procedure codes for THA or TKA are present

Statistical Process Control (SPC) measures
The following measures pertain to this cohort in the Statistical Process Control section of Scorecards.
Key measures
- Length of Stay (LOS)
- 1 to 30 Day Readmission Rate Forward
- Charges - Principal Procedure (sum of OR Charges on the day of the Principal Procedure)
Adverse events
These measures flag the encounter if the condition is present. The adverse events are aggregated in the Adverse Event bar chart.
- Any PSI
- Any HAC
- Usage - ICU
- Usage - Blood Use
- AMI within 7 days of index admission
- Pneumonia within 7 days of index admission
- Sepsis within 7 days of index admission
- Surgical site bleed within 30 days of index admission
- Pulmonary embolism within 30 days of index admission
- Mortality within 30 days of admission
- Mechanical complications within 90 days of index admission
- Periprosthetic joint/wound infection with 90 days of index admission
- Unexplained Cardiac Arrest
- Reaction to Anesthesia
